Sergio Ramos spoke to the press after Spain's tight 1-0 win over Iran on Wednesday evening to put them top of Group B.

The World Cup: "In the World Cup it's about the results. It was never going to be easy". 

Queiroz's comments on Salah's injury: "I'm not going to discuss his comments. It's not for me to say. We'd like to win another way, but it's the result that counts". 

Referee: "I'm not going to give my personal opinion on the referees. He gave them a lot of leeway and seemed to blow up on everything we did. You have to keep a cool head". 

Iran: "When they conceded they had to react. Now they have to beat Portugal. We're happy with the win". 

Aspects to improve: "In everything. You can always improve in every department. Every game is different and you approach each one differently. Defensively, take your chances more, shoot more from outside the box, be more effective...".

Maradona: "I respect Maradona because he's one of the game's greats. In my opinion he was a genius, but I'd also add that in Argentinian football everyone knows that Maradona is light years behind the number-one, which is Messi".
